    Johnny Depp Sued For Hitting Crew Member On Set

    Hollywood star Johnny Depp has been sued for allegedly punching a crew member on his movie set 'City of Lies’. If we go by the reports, Gregg 'Rocky' Brooks alleged that Depp punched him twice on the set. It is said the incident happened on April 13, 2017, when Depp, 55, was filming outside the Barclay Hotel in downtown Los Angeles.

    Brooks also claimed that he was fired from the movie, 'City of Lies' when he refused to sign papers saying that he wouldn't sue the actor over the incident. The lawsuit said that Depp screamed inappropriately at Brooks and punched him twice in the ribs. It is also reported that Depp offered him 100,000 dollars to punch him back.

    Moreover, as per the reports, Mr Brooks claims Depp’s breath “reeked of alcohol” and he alleges he had been taking drugs on set. Apart from this, the movie is produced by Miriam Segal and Paul M. Brennan. The 'City of Lies' will hit the theatres in September this year.
